Ban Zhao, courtesy name Ji (名姬), courtesy name Huiban, was born into a Confucian family that had been officials for generations. Her family is almost related to "history", her father is the famous great literary hero, historian Ban Biao, the eldest brother Ban Gu is also a historian, wrote China's first biographical body of the history of the Dynasty - "Book of Han", the second brother is the idiom "throw pen from Rong" prototype figure Ban Chao, across the western region for thirty-one years, not only opened up the Silk Road, but also on the road of the Silk Road, making more than fifty countries along the way and Han friendship.

In such an excellent family, Ban Zhao was familiar with the Hundred Classics of the Sons from an early age, and later mastered a wealth of astronomical and geographical knowledge, and was the only woman to participate in the history books. So where is Ban Zhaozhi??

Ban Zhao's father, Ban Biao, taking Sima Qian as a model, had been determined to write the Book of Han since he was young, and before that, Ban Biao began a long process of collecting materials, but he did not want to, and only wrote a beginning and died.

Ban Zhao's second song Ban Gu, in order to fulfill his father's last wishes, spent twenty years to continue to write the "Book of Han", the content of which was written to Emperor Zhang, and before it was completed, he was killed by the traitors and imprisoned because he was implicated in the murder of the great general Dou Xian.

After Ban Gu's death, the Book of Han not only had the "Eight Tables" and the Astronomical Chronicle not yet been completed, but also the manuscripts were scattered and urgently needed to be sorted out. When Emperor Han and Emperor He learned of this, they killed the traitors and ordered Ban Zhao to inherit his father's and brother's will and continue to write the Book of Han.

Imagine how a weak woman could complete the repair of the Book of Han in such a messy situation.

However, Ban Zhao did. She tirelessly read a large number of historical books in the library over the years, sorted out and proofread the scattered chapters left by her father and brother, and finally completed the "Book of Han" at the age of 40, and wrote eight tables and "Astronomical Records" on the basis of the original manuscript.

When later generations evaluated the Book of Han, they unanimously agreed that these two chapters were the most difficult and tricky to write, which shows that Ban Zhao's talent was high, and in that feudal period, it was unprecedented for women to participate in the writing, and it can be said that the Book of Han began with The Great Confucian and ended with a woman.

Ban Zhao's second brother, Ban Chao, had worked diligently in the Western Regions for decades, and because of his old age and missing his family, he repeatedly went to the emperor and asked to return to his hometown, but Emperor Hanhe only said that he would stick to his post and did not mention the matter of returning to his hometown.

After Ban Zhao knew about it, he handed the emperor a recital overnight, which was called "Seeking Substitutes for Brother Chao" by later generations, and the content of the text was meticulous and gentle, which could not help but make the Han and Emperor at that time soft, so they immediately recalled Ban Chao.

Although Ban Chao died of illness less than a month after his return, he died properly, and the two brothers and sisters also met for the last time. Just think, how can a piece of paper make the stubborn emperor soften his heart? This sonata, which is known as one of the classic works of ancient literature, is full of Ban Zhao's brotherly feelings, which is comparable to the text of the "Chen Qing Table".

The first two stories may not be known to many people, but "The Female Commandment" must have been heard by many people.

The book is 1800 words long, and the rulers have vigorously advocated it for thousands of years, and have even been called "women's must-read textbooks". Ban Zhao wrote this book with the intention of educating women on how to be a woman, but he did not want to be hollowed out by the rulers and moralists of later generations, and was widely promoted and over-interpreted, so that Ban Cai's daughter became a representative of advocating feudal gangchang, which was also the source of "female thieves".

Why did later people attack Ban Zhao?

The reason is in this book, the beginning of the book: the ancient man gave birth to a daughter for three days, under the bed, and made bricks and tiles. That is to say, in ancient times, if a girl was born, in the first three days of birth, he let her sleep under the bed and give her a spindle as a toy. Why use a spindle as a toy, is to let her know that a woman is born without status, that is, to work, to make her humble.

And giving birth to a boy is different, to "carry the bed of sleep, carry the clothes of the clothes, carry the Zhang", that is to say, give birth to a boy to sleep on a tall bed, wear gorgeous clothes, and use jade as a toy. Let the boy know that he is noble. Because of such a sentence, it caused the anger of later generations.

In fact, from today's point of view, this move is really inappropriate, but we must know that Ban Zhao's original intention in writing this book was to educate his daughter, which belongs to the category of family style and tutoring, and such words are also recorded in the "Book of Poetry", not that she initiated this move.

Moreover, as soon as the "Female Commandment" was born, it became a tool for the ruling class to use, so it was vigorously promoted, and even over-interpreted, with the purpose of achieving a complete male supremacy through the complete suppression of women. Today, it seems that blindly advocating women's feminine restraint and grievances is completely unreasonable.
